Technical Specifications
Parameter Name | Parameter Value |
---|---|
Product Model | IC698ACC701 |
Manufacturer | GE |
Product Type | Auxiliary Smart Battery Module |
Series | PACSystems RX7i |
Application | RX7i system, providing RAM backup for CPUs |
Max Current Rating | 15.0 amps |
Operating Temperature Range | 0 to 60 degrees Celsius |
Battery Content | 5.1 grams lithium |
Casing Material | Flame – retardant ABS plastic |
Max Shelf Life | 7 years |
Max Battery Life | 200 days |
Approximate Dimensions (H x W x D) | 5.713 x 2.5 x 1.5 inches |
Connectors | Embedded 4 – pin female JAE connector and factory – supplied 4 – pin male to 2 – pin female connector |

Main Features and Advantages
Extended Battery Life: With a maximum battery capacity of 15 amps – hours and a standard shelf life of 7 years at 20 degrees Celsius storage temperature, the module offers extended periods of reliable operation. When used as a memory battery backup for certain RX3i PACSystems CPUs like the IC695CPU310 or IC695CMU310, it has a maximum battery life of 200 days. Even for other RX3i CPUs such as the IC695CPU320/Cru320 or IC695CPU315, it still provides a reasonable 23 – day maximum battery life.
Robust Casing: Housed in a flame – retardant ABS plastic casing, the GE IC698ACC701 is well – protected against harsh environmental conditions. This ensures its durability and functionality, even in challenging industrial settings where factors like dust, heat, and potential fire hazards may be present.

Installation and Maintenance
Maintenance recommendations: To increase the efficiency and lifespan of the GE IC698ACC701, power on the central processing unit before connecting the battery. When the battery is not in use, disconnect the enabling cable to further extend its lifespan. Regularly monitor the battery status through the smart monitoring feature. When the battery reaches the end of its life, dispose of it following the proper guidelines provided with the product to ensure environmental safety.
